United Caps has been awarded Most Welcomed Packaging Solution of the Year at the Dairy Asia Pacific Summit 2019 for its 127 SAFE-TE closure.

Designed for baby food safety, 127 SAFE-TE was a standout in the category, said Adhi Lukmann, chair of the Indonesia Food and Beverage Association.

“With its rapidly increasing population and emerging middle-class consumers, Asia has the highest growth in demand for milk and dairy products in the world and an expanding appetite for health and wellness solutions.

“This includes a demand for safety, convenience and a premium look in baby food packaging. The award presented to United Caps for its new 127 SAFE-TE closure is well-deserved as its innovative approach to this new closure ticks all those boxes and more,” he said.

According to Benoit Henckes, CEO of United Caps, the flip-top hinged closure allows easy preparation of infant formula bottles for both left- and right-handed people; includes a tamper-evident band that makes it obvious if the product has been opened; and incorporates anti-counterfeiting solutions.

“Not only does the 127 SAFE-TE closure address concerns about product purity, but it also includes effective security solutions and a more premium look, both of which are important to consumers in the Asian market.

“It builds on popular Protecscoop features – ease of preparation, scoop hygiene and more – while adding a truly exceptional tamper-evident feature with our state-of-the-art Flexband technology and ‘drop down’ lock.

“At the same time, it only requires very minor changes to existing capping/filling lines, important for infant nutrition manufacturers, for whom extensive changes can be very expensive and time consuming,” said Henckes.

United Caps products are distributed in Australia by Caps & Closures. The 127 SAFE-TE is available in 127mm format, with 99mm on the way; production for the Asian market will begin next September in Kulim, Malaysia.
